Can anyone please tell me where the plug is for the EOBD / OBD is location on my 2006 Croma?

Thanks

Dave
 
It's behind the cubby hole on the dashboard where your right knee is. You have to remove a philips screw to get the cover off.

Is there an EOBD/OBE port on a Croma CHT/IE ?

This is the old original version of the Croma 1992 and in does not have an EOBD socket.

Connections to the Engine ECU and ABS system, etc. are via Fiat 3-Pin connector interface.

MultiECUScan support the Croma 92 but only the Engine and ABS ECUs. You will also need the 3-Pin adapter cable.
